A six-month pedestrian access trial will take place at Hedge End, New Alresford and Waterlooville, permitting residents living near those centres, to walk-in and drop off their waste during dedicated, pedestrian-only access times. When household waste recycling centres reopened in May 2020 - following two months of closure due to the first Covid-19 lockdown - queues tailed back for miles across the county, forcing Hampshire County Council to introduce a booking system a month later. The 24 Hampshire Waste Recycling Centres recycle, reuse, compost and recover energy from 83.72% of the material brought in by 4 million visitors each year.
